Commit aef05658 authored by Will Schroeder
BUG:Make sure correct observer is set (must be consistent with requested cursor shape)

......@@ -20,7 +20,7 @@
#include "vtkInteractorObserver.h"
#include <vtkstd/map>
vtkCxxRevisionMacro(vtkObserverMediator, "1.3");
vtkCxxRevisionMacro(vtkObserverMediator, "1.4");
// PIMPL the map representing the observer (key) to cursor request
......@@ -119,7 +119,7 @@ int vtkObserverMediator::RequestCursorShape(vtkInteractorObserver *w, int reques
iter = this->ObserverMap->end();
--iter; //this is the observer with the highest priority
this->CurrentObserver = w;
this->CurrentObserver = (*iter).first;
this->CurrentCursorShape = (*iter).second;
return 1;
